C語言筆記 第一課 資料型別 狄泰學院

2021-08-25 08:05:24 字數 703 閱讀 9740

什麼是資料型別?

資料結構可以理解為固定記憶體大小的別名

資料型別是建立變數的模子

資料型別的本質

1byte char 記憶體空間

2byte short

4byte int

變數的本質—連續記憶體的名字

變數是一段實際連續儲存空間的別名

程式中通過變數來申請並命名儲存空間

通過變數的名字可以使用儲存空間

記憶體使用者資料區

3000 2 變數i

3004 4 變數j

3008 6 變數k

3100 3004 變數p

1-1  型別與變數的關係

include int main()

1-2 自定義型別與建立變數

include typedef

int int32;

typedef

unsigned

char byte;

typedef

struct _tag_ts

ts;int main()

小結:

資料型別的本質是乙個模子

資料型別代表需要占用的記憶體大小

變數的本質是一段記憶體的別名

變數隸屬於某一種資料型別

變數所在的記憶體的大小取決於其所屬的資料型別

C語言第一課

一 c基礎 進製的轉換 進製,進製機制 常見的有二進位制 八進位制 十進位制 十六進製制 例 二進位制 0101010 八進位制 0235 十進位制 9 十六進製制 0x8a 注 十六進製制後面的10 16由a,b,c,d,e,f代替 進製的區分 八進位制前面會加 0 十六進製制後面會加 0x 進製...

C語言第一課

開始的第乙個程式是乙個最簡單的程式,也就是最經典的hello world程式,它的功能為列印出hello world。程式的內容非常簡單,也是c語言編寫程式的基本結構框架。機構的電腦是基於虛擬機器的,其程式設計是gcc的。1.建立hello.c檔案 vim hello.c2.編寫hello worl...

c語言第一課

c語言第一課 型別 不僅定義了資料元素的內容,還定義了這類資料上可以進行的運算。編譯 執行程式 程式原始檔命名約定 cc cxx cpp cp及.c 從命令列執行編譯器 cc test1.cc 其中cc是編譯器程式的名字。編譯器生成乙個可執行檔案。windows系統將會生成可執行檔案 prog1.e...